Founded in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been dedicated to reducing the time to market for innovators developing new medical devices. The company specializes by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times typically between 1 to 3 days—an achievement not achievable with larger EO sterilization services.
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ard recognized the significant need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for active development programs innovating inn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is crucial in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old valuable value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.
Besides rout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. The Importance of Medical Device Sterilization
Controlling infections remains a key element of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Appropriate sterilization of medical devices drastically re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ers both. Substandard sterilization can give rise to outbreaks of life-threatening di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.
Sterilization Techniques for Medical Devices
The science behind sterilization has developed extensively over the last century, utilizing a variety of methods suited to numerous types of devices and materials. Some of the most popularly adopted techniques include:
Autoclaving (Steam Sterilization)
Autoclaving remains the most frequent and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is prompt, cost-efficient, and eco-conscious,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Advanced Materials and Device Complexity
The rise of intricate med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ization systems capable of handling detailed materials. Developments in sterilization include methods especially low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ging fragile components.
